| Plan | Price | Features listed | Step up from the tier below |
|---|---|---|---|
| Zwift | $19.99/month | 2 | Entry tier |
| Zwift Annual | $199.99/year | 1 | +$180/year, 1 more feature |

Zwift
$19.99/monthThe entry tier. It covers unlimited cycling and running in the virtual world, group rides, races and structured workouts.
Zwift Annual
$199.99/yearOver Zwift, this tier adds:
- Same features billed yearly

People bring Zwift in for a cyclist who finds indoor trainer sessions boring and wants a social, game-like world to ride in, a runner and cyclist who wants one subscription covering both activities, someone motivated by group rides, races and leaderboards rather than a plain data screen, a household with an apple tv wanting to ride without a separate laptop or tablet setup.
